Economy in Wiehl is booming: Successful first business meeting 2025!
On February 11, 2025, the first Wiehler Wirtschaftstreff took place in the rooms of the BGS Beta-Gamma-Service GmbH & Co. KG. The organizers were the city of Wiehl and the economic development of the Oberberg district. This kick -off event attracted around 80 representatives of Wiehler companies and served the goal of making contacts, enabling an exchange and collecting fresh impulses for the economy. Managing Director Dr. Andreas Ostrowicki emphasized the immense importance of networking in times of change. Mayor Ulrich Stücker said that the format aims to build a local network to improve the framework conditions for companies. Frank Herhaus, department for planning, regional development and the environment, described the event as great success and emphasized the support of the economy.

development and investments in the region
The close cooperation between companies, local authorities and educational institutions promotes economic development. An example of this is the Bergisches resource smithy in Lindlar, which is promoted as an innovation location. 6.5 million euros flow into development. In addition, the 2023 urban development program provides for investments of 16.5 million euros for various development projects in the Oberberg district, including the qualification of the Jägerhof in Bergneustadt and the upgrading of Wilhelmplatz in Hückeswagen. Mühlenstraße is also redesigned in Wiehl.
A central concern is the creation of new anchor tenants in Gummersbach, where four million euros are invested in a forum. These investments are not only important for the local economy, because they create jobs and promote growth.

The funding program of the federal-state community task "Improving the regional economic structure" (GRW) aims to support structurally weak regions. The reforms of 2022 attach particular importance to the creation of jobs, combat location disadvantages and the promotion of a climate -neutral and sustainable economy.
